Three pounds of bananas weigh $1.89. How much is it for 5 lbs of bananas

Respuesta :

ogathers733 ogathers733
  • 03-12-2020

Answer:

The correct answer is $3.15

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the answer you do $1.89 divided by 3 to find the unit rate,which is 63 cents. Then you do 5 times 63 cents to equal $3.15.
